Larsson, Bernt – 1974
This report describes a test of the robustness of factor-analytic methods in the face of various types of scale transformations on the data. Because of the complexities that would be involved in an exact analytical investigation, the tests were done with simulated sets of data having different factor structures. Moritz, Jonathan – Mathematics Education Research Journal, 2003
Coordinate graphs of time-series data have been significant in the history of statistical graphing and in recent school mathematics curricula. A survey task to construct a graph to represent data about temperature change over time was administered to 133 students in Grades 3, 5, 7, and 9.
